Technology Jobs in Vermont: Frequently Asked Questions

Which technology companies in Vermont sponsor work visas?

Major Vermont tech employers sponsoring visas include Dealer.com (now Cox Automotive), MyWebGrocer, Beta Technologies, and GlobalFoundries. Smaller companies like Faraday and Champlain College's tech initiatives also sponsor H-1B visa and other work visas for software engineers, data scientists, and cybersecurity specialists.

How to find technology visa sponsorship jobs in Vermont?

Use Migrate Mate to search specifically for Vermont technology roles that offer visa sponsorship. Filter by visa type (H-1B, E-3 visa, TN visa) and location within Vermont. Many positions are concentrated in Burlington's tech corridor, with opportunities also emerging in Montpelier and Brattleboro as the state's tech ecosystem expands.

Which visa types are most common for technology roles in Vermont?

H-1B visas dominate Vermont tech sponsorship, particularly for software engineers and cybersecurity roles. TN visas are common for Canadian tech workers given Vermont's border location. E-3 visas serve Australian professionals, while O-1 visas occasionally appear for senior roles at companies like Beta Technologies in aerospace technology.

Which Vermont cities have the most technology visa sponsorship opportunities?

Burlington leads with the highest concentration of tech sponsorship jobs, housing companies like Dealer.com and numerous startups. Montpelier offers government tech roles, while Williston and South Burlington host manufacturing tech companies. Essex and Colchester also feature growing tech clusters near the University of Vermont.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ored technology jobs in Vermont?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
